What's the difference between a 'grey water' and 'black water' insurance claim in NJ?

Category 2 Grey Water (e.g., dishwasher overflow) contains chemical or biological contaminants and requires specific antimicrobial treatment. Category 3 Black Water (sewage, floodwater) is a hazardous material requiring full containment and disposal. Proper categorization dictates protocol and coverage. What is the first critical step I should take after discovering a major water leak?

Immediately shut off the main water valve to stop the intrusion. This is the single most effective action to mitigate 'loss of use' and prevent further Category escalation. Know your valve's location. If you are near the Pemberton Township Municipal Building and are unsure, contact your utility provider for emergency shut-off guidance. Rapid source containment is the foundation of all successful restoration.

How quickly does mold become a problem after a leak in my home?

The IICRC-defined mold growth window is 48-72 hours from the initial water intrusion. For Category 2 (grey water) incidents, this window is critical. As of 2026, standard insurance policy language assigns liability for mold proliferation to the property owner if documented, professional mitigation does not begin within this window. Timely, compliant drying is a financial and structural imperative.

Why does my flooded floor in Browns Mills feel dry but still needs structural drying?

Dry to the touch' does not meet the IICRC S500 standard of care. Wood and concrete in Pemberton Township must be dried to a psychrometric equilibrium of 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F. Residual moisture creates vapor pressure, driving water into wall cavities and subfloors, which leads to hidden structural decay. Our moisture mapping ensures materials are dry by this scientific standard, not just surface-dry.

How does Pemberton Township's Flood Zone AE rating affect my water damage restoration?

Zone AE indicates a 1% annual chance of flooding with base flood elevations determined. Per 2026 FEMA Risk MAP updates, this mandates enhanced structural drying protocols for basements and crawlspaces in Pemberton Township. Restoration must account for saturated sub-slab soils and hydrostatic pressure, often requiring extended drying times and specialized equipment like desiccant dehumidifiers to prevent recurrent moisture issues and meet the elevated dry standard.
